Output ef5adc1f018f3041634b025afa3d441f1f25d18c8f63222916ba86bcef2cc013:22

value
11528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c7c2c4a3bbf52f9c41ae0c1fb65b41784318dc OP_EQUAL
address
3CFCwEE9p7zwc7JqoFt1XAcdHTnBxEeBbC
transaction
ef5adc1f018f3041634b025afa3d441f1f25d18c8f63222916ba86bcef2cc013
spent
true